Kunzite Spec & Origins Mineral Family: Spodumene (pyroxene group); lithium aluminum silicate (LiAlSi₂O₆) Crystal Structure: Monoclinic prismatic—forms elongated, blade-like crystals with perfect cleavage in two directions Hardness: 6.5–7 on the Mohs scale—reasonably durable but needs care due to cleavage and potential abrasion Refractive Index: Approximately 1.660–1.681; birefringence around 0.014–0.016—creates strong brilliance and pleochroic effects Specific Gravity: ~3.15–3.21 Luster: Vitreous (glass-like) Color: Ranges from pale pink to lavender, sometimes with stronger
